One of the most popular business motto’s within the past year is "more for less." Organizations want things better, faster, and cheaper. In the IT world this is all too true as well. Business process management (BPM) is the tool that delivers faster, better, and cheaper solutions. BPM is a discipline and a methodological approach which changes IT's conversation with the business to an interactive, continuously-iterative approach to building solutions. BPM takes the IT conversation into the language of the business – addressing one of the perennial problems of IT: the business-IT communications gap.
